Satura rādītājs:

Wemos DHT11 PIR sensors ar releju: 3 soļi
Wemos DHT11 PIR sensors ar releju: 3 soļi

Video: Wemos DHT11 PIR sensors ar releju: 3 soļi

Video: Wemos DHT11 PIR sensors ar releju: 3 soļi
Video: Tutorial - Multi-sensor setups for ESP32 & Home Assistant 2024, Jūlijs
Anonim
Wemos DHT11 PIR sensors ar releju
Wemos DHT11 PIR sensors ar releju
Wemos DHT11 PIR sensors ar releju
Wemos DHT11 PIR sensors ar releju

Šie ir norādījumi par to, kā pieslēgt un programmēt Wemos mini D1, lai tas varētu nolasīt temperatūru no DHT11, un jūs varat manipulēt ar informāciju, izmantojot lietotni Blynk, izmantojot WIFI. Izmantojot lietotni Blynk, varēsiet grafiski attēlot vērtības (mitrums un vai temperatūra), un, ja vēlaties, varat iestatīt notikumus, izmantojot lietotni Blynk, padarot to ērtāku, jo mēs varam izmantot lietotni, nevis pārrakstīt Arduino IDE kodēto kodu. katru reizi, kad mēs vēlamies modificēt vai pievienot notikumu (skatiet vietni www.blynk.cc) Otrais būs “cietais kods”, es to saucu tā, jo, ja vēlaties modificēt kodu, tas būs manuāli jāaugšupielādē, izmantojot kompilatoru kā paredzēts lietotnes Blynk lietošanai, kods ir paredzēts PIR sensoram un relejam. Es arī iekļaušu savu STL failu savam pielāgotajam korpusam, ja vēlaties to izdrukāt. Es to daru kā hobiju, un esmu diezgan jauns šajā jomā. Ja ir kādi ieteikumi, kā es varētu to uzlabot, noteikti dariet man zināmu.

MĒRĶIS:

Wemos mini D1 varēs nolasīt temperatūru un mitrumu un noteikt kustību caur PIR. Ko jūs ar to vēlaties darīt, ir atkarīgs no jums. Lietotne Blynk piedāvā daudzas iespējas, kā izmantot šo konfigurāciju. Mans kods ir iestatīts tā, lai relejs būtu ieslēgts 30 minūtes. Jūs esat laipni aicināti to mainīt, ja vēlaties, izmantojot kodu.

Alternatīvi var būt opcija Lasīt temperatūru no istabas un ar šo vērtību, izmantojot lietotni Blynk izveidot pat ar IF paziņojumiem. Piemēram, es varu nolasīt temperatūru un iestatīt to, JA istabas temperatūra ir augstāka par šo temperatūru (ļauj iestatīt to uz 90 grādiem), tad atveriet releju; Maiņstrāvu var pieslēgt relejam, tādēļ, kad istabas temperatūra ir virs noteiktās temperatūras, maiņstrāva ieslēgsies. Pretējā gadījumā relejs ir izslēgts. BET jums tas būs jāpārkodē un jāpadara spraudnis, lai relejs būtu savienots ar virtuālo, un pēc tam jānosūta uz lietotni blynk, lai jūs varētu manipulēt ar releju, izmantojot lietotni

1. darbība:

Attēls
Attēls

Šādi es pievienoju savu Wemos D1. Es iemācījos grūti, ka jūs nevarat neko savienot ar GPIO0, GPIO2 un/vai GPIO15, pretējā gadījumā tā nevarēs atiestatīt tāfeles programmēšanas režīmā un neļaus man augšupielādēt savu skici, kamēr kaut kas ir savienots ar kādu no šīm tapām. Es nomainīju savu PIR tapu no D4 (GPIO2) uz D1.

2. darbība:

Attēls
Attēls

Šis ir mans pielāgotais korpuss, kas labi atbilst visām manām sastāvdaļām. Tam ir stiprinājums sienas kontaktligzdai un caurums aizmugurē kabeļiem. Ja jums nav 3D printera, no HomeDepot varat uzņemt 1-Gang kontaktligzdu, tikai pārliecinieties, vai komponenti ir piemēroti. Nākotnē es pārtaisīšu korpusu un pievienošu vietu sieviešu mikro USB, lai man nebūtu jānoņem Wemos no tā korpusa jebkurā laikā, kad vēlos tajā augšupielādēt skici.

3. darbība:

Pievienots Vai Wemods D1 kods. Atverot Arduino IDE, mainiet WIFI tīklu, paroli, Blynk Auth kodu un pēc tam augšupielādējiet skici.

Ieteicams: